Recalibrate again. 1. let saw idle in choke mode for 30-60 secs. regardless of temp of the saw. 2.pin throttle wide open. saw will blubber for awhile. keep throttle pinned 3. saw will eventually come out of blubber mode and start screaming. 4. keep throttle pinned until the saw goes from screaming to falling on its face. 5. after saw comes off of screaming ( even with throttle held wide open), then let off the throttle Looked like you let off the throttle too soon. Saw needs to come off of screaming mode by itself

The last couple of cuts after the idle session were a lot better. If it were an older saw I would guess coil but I know nothing of the new ones. And little of the older ones. For first attemps at sq. filing it looked like it was cutting pretty good.I have been around quite a few fallers and almost without exception they file from the outside in or into the tooth. The thing about outside in is you can see better, especially the corner.You just have to figure out how to do it without chattering. Your filing clamp looks great! That should help a lot. Magnifing glasses help. May or may not have to one hand file, with other hand holding the tooth. I would stick with the double bevel files and forget the regular flat file. Egan didn’t port this one, there is no reflash on an mtronic. They did update coils on some of the sizes certain years to fix issues but unless they went to a re writable memory in the new ones it was a set rpm based map in the coil doing fuel adjustments. You needed change the coil to get the updated parameters.

The stalling of the saw is caused by going from WOT (case full of fuel), to a dead stop almost instantly. Mtronic has a tough time with that scenario. Running a less aggressive chain will help to not create that scenario.
